Former Twin Falls Times-News opinion editor Jon Alexander opines for the Southern Illinoisan:
Mainstream Republicans must finally disavow the increasingly dangerous radicals who’ve infiltrated the Party of Lincoln before it’s too late. Heavily armed right-wing vigilantes rolled into Ferguson, Missouri, Tuesday, stoking already inflamed racial tensions. A platoon of angry white men, calling themselves “Oath Keepers,” thought it would be a good idea to don paramilitary gear, strap on assault weapons and head to Ferguson. Racial tensions are again simmering as African-American protesters, marking the one-year anniversary of Micheal Brown’s death, clashed with police. Law enforcement had enough on their hands. The last thing they needed were self-appointed “constitutionalists” taunting an already unhappy mob with their special brand of gun-toting intimidation. Their presence was “both unnecessary and inflammatory,” said St. Louis County Police Chief Jon Belmar in a statement. Belmar is absolutely correct.
